Crans Montana 100th Anniversary Walk
The Crans Montana 100th Anniversary Walk was signposted to commemorate the history of the Crans Montana tourist resort in 1993. From the Ballesteros Golf Course, you will stroll down the shopping streets of Crans, walk alongside Lake Grenon, and cross the Ycoor Gardens, all before discovering a mineral cave with a beautiful viewpoint above it. This is a great day hike if you are looking to take in the beauty of Crans Montana.

Route Description for Crans Montana 100th Anniversary Walk
Departing from Crans and its Severiano Ballesteros golf course, the Crans Montana 100th Anniversary Walk will take you through charming shopping streets with their luxury boutiques, local produce and sports shops.
Crossing the resort towards Montana, you will be guided towards Lake Grenon and the Parc Hill, where you will see the resort's first hotel. Upon arriving in Montana, you can pause for a break and try your chance at the casino or let your spirit wander in the Ycoor gardens, a magnificent oasis of tranquility in the heart of the resort where the New Zealand writer Katherine Mansfield regularly came to recharge her batteries.
After, the route passes by old sanatoriums that contributed to the economic development and renown of the resort. The history continues at the bottom of the Nationale piste, the famous stage for the Alpine skiing world championships. These took place in 1987, the golden era of Swiss skiing, with its heroes Pirmin Zurbriggen, Peter Müller and Erika Hess, to name but a few. Eventually, you will arrive at the endpoint of the Crans Montana 100th Anniversary Walk in Aminona.
Getting to the Crans Montana 100th Anniversary Walk Trailhead
To reach Crans-Montana by car, take the exit of the A9 motorway (Rhône motorway) called "Sierre ouest". At the motorway exit, turn left and follow the signs for "Sierre". At the roundabout, turn right. Continue for 500 m, then at the entrance to Sierre, turn left following the signs for "Crans-Montana".
Once you arrive in Crans-Montana, follow the signs for the "Le Regent" car park.
